  abstract  = {We present in this paper a purely rule-based system for Question Classification
	which we divide into two parts: The first is the extraction of relevant words
	from a question by use of its structure, and the second is the classification
	of questions based on rules that associate these words to Concepts. We achieve
	an accuracy of 97.2%, close to a 6 point improvement over the previous State of
	the Art of 91.6%. Additionally, we believe that machine learning algorithms can
	be applied on top of this method to further improve accuracy.},
